Suska sechlońska PGI prune energy balls

Quick and easy to prepare, these prune energy balls are healthy, nutritious, and singed with the smoky sweetness of Suska sechlońska PGI.

How to prepare

Ingredients

  • 170 g cashew nuts
  • 200 g Suska sechlońska PGI (pitted)
  • 30 g cocoa powder
  • 50 g shredded coconut

Instructions

1. Grind the cashew nuts in a food processor.

2. Add 30 g cocoa powder and a pinch of salt

3. Add 200 g Suska sechlońska PGI (pitted)

4. Mix until combined

5. Shape the dough into approximately 20 balls.

6. Roll the balls in the shredded coconut.

7. Enjoy! It’s Suska sechlońska PGI prune energy balls.

Reasons to love Suska sechlońska PGI

Suska sechlońska PGI is a sweet and sticky smoked prune, produced in fire-heated kilns across the rolling hills of southern Poland.

Local producers tend to the fires and churn the layers of plums; as the chambers fill with smoke and warm air, the plums baste in their natural sugars and juices, creating a unique blend of smoky sweetness.
